That's a neutral start switch. If it's a manual tranny save yourself the time and go buy a new one for around $25. If it's an auto pray you can get it off in one piece cause it costs almost $300. I tried to take mine off for cleaning once and could barely get it to wiggle. The walkthroughs I have read say it should just slide off but I couldn't get it to happen. Good luck.

cruiser54 01-14-2013 05:45 AM

Remove the nut from the shaft after bending back the retaining tabs. Remove teh adjusting bolt. Spray the shaft area liberally with a good penetrating oil.

Use a wooden shim shingle behind the switch to slowly pull it away from the trans. Once it moves, remove the shingle, push it in and pul on it some more. Spray with penetrant. Repeat the use of the shingle etc until it comes off.
